  • Tissues retain memories of inflammation, enhancing sensitivity to future assaults.
  • Epidermal stem cells in mice store lifelong epigenetic records of psoriasis-like skin flares.
  • CpG dinucleotide density is identified as a major driver of memory persistence in chromatin dynamics.
  • CpG-enriched sequences are essential for reinforcing accessibility across cellular generations.
  • Memory persistence involves DNA demethylation, methylation-sensitive transcription factors, nucleosome disaffinity, and histone variant H2A.Z.
  • DNA sequences orchestrate persistent poise, affecting tissue fitness upon recall.
